    Issue: Cannot call constructor - vault/core/controller/asset/xf.php:23

      Cannot call constructor - vault/core/controller/asset/xf.php:23

      Code:
      Fehlerinformation
      Error: Cannot call constructor - vault/core/controller/asset/xf.php:23
      Generiert durch: Unbekanntes Benutzerkonto, Heute um 12:11 Uhr
      Stapelverfolgung
      #0 ../vault/core/model/vw.php(404): vw_Asset_Controller_XF->__construct()
      #1 ../vault/core/model/vw.php(696): vw_Hard_Core::fetch_object('Controller', 'Asset', '')
      #2 ../library/vw/XenForo/ControllerPublic/Wiki/Asset.php(42): vw_Hard_Core::controller('Asset')
      #3 ../library/XenForo/FrontController.php(351): vw_XenForo_ControllerPublic_Wiki_Asset->actionIndex()
      #4 ../library/XenForo/FrontController.php(134): XenForo_FrontController->dispatch(Object(XenForo_RouteMatch))
      #5 ../index.php(13): XenForo_FrontController->run()
      #6 {main}

      This is already fixed in build 002. In vault/core/controller/asset/xf.php, find and remove:
      Code:
      parent::__construct();

      This fix was folded into build 002 on March 18. If you downloaded build 002 on March 16 or 17, it did not include this fix.

      In general, we allow a 48-hour period after initial publishing of a build where new reports can be folded into the same build -- you may recall reports where I've said "Fixed in the current build" or something like that. After 48-hours, the fix must wait until a new release or a new build.
